Description

This dataset includes publications analysed in systematic mapping of academic literature reporting case studies of 3D visualisations that have been utilised or developed for communicative urban and landscape planning contexts. The publications have been published between 2013 and mid-2020. The Excel file consists of two sheets: valid entries of the matrix and the data matrix itself. The data has been arranged into columns, which describe several variables characterising the content of each publication. The variables are explained in the related research article by Eilola et al.
